Palantir AIP is an operating system for the modern enterprise, bringing the power of large language models and other AI capabilities directly into an organization's operations. It enables users to integrate their data, models, and logic into a common operating picture, facilitating more informed decision-making and automated workflows. The promise of Artificial Intelligence in Procurement (AIP) extends far beyond theoretical discussions, manifesting in tangible and transformative results across diverse industries. Companies are leveraging AIP to automate routine tasks, such as invoice processing and supplier onboarding, freeing up procurement teams to focus on strategic initiatives. For instance, manufacturers are employing AI-powered predictive analytics to anticipate supply chain disruptions, enabling proactive sourcing and mitigating risks. Retailers, meanwhile, are using AIP to optimize inventory management, personalize supplier interactions, and negotiate more favorable terms. This shift from manual, reactive processes to automated, data-driven decision-making isn't just about efficiency; it's about building more resilient, agile, and cost-effective supply chains that can adapt to ever-changing market demands. The practical application of AIP is proving to be a game-changer, driving significant ROI and reshaping how businesses operate.
